In a surprising turn of events on Monday Night Football, the Atlanta Falcons secured a 22-21 victory over the Philadelphia Eagles thanks to a last-minute drive led by quarterback Kirk Cousins. The game-changing play came when the Eagles failed to convert a crucial third-down situation in the red zone, leading to a field goal attempt that brought the score to 18-15. With just 1:39 left on the clock, Cousins orchestrated an impressive drive with no timeouts, culminating in a touchdown pass to Drake London that silenced the home crowd at Lincoln Financial Field. Despite a penalty for excessive celebration on the extra point attempt, kicker Younghoe Koo secured the win for the Falcons.

The Eagles, despite having all of their timeouts remaining, were unable to mount a successful drive after Cousins’ heroics, as Jalen Hurts threw an interception to seal the victory for Atlanta. The win brings both teams to a 1-1 record for the season. Cousins, who had struggled earlier in the game, redeemed himself with a stellar performance, completing 20 of 29 passes for 241 yards and two touchdowns. Wide receiver Darnell Mooney played a crucial role in the Falcons’ victory, recording the night’s longest play with a 41-yard touchdown catch. On the Eagles’ side, DeVonta Smith stood out as a top receiver with a touchdown before Mooney’s decisive play.

Despite facing a three-point deficit late in the game, the Falcons managed to stage a remarkable comeback, erasing the Eagles’ lead with a series of clutch plays by Cousins and the offense. Running backs Bijan Robinson and Saquon Barkley contributed significantly to their teams’ rushing efforts, with Robinson leading the game with 97 yards on the ground. Hurts, who had displayed efficiency throughout the game, ultimately faltered with a costly interception, allowing the Falcons to secure the victory.
